Unless you have lived at a 1:1 brick area you know that Epic's Fortnite: Battle Royale has taken over the world. The game has acquired players to PlayerUnknown's Battlegrounds at a remarkably fast pace an rival, but today the pupil is now the master. Beyond that people are enjoying Fortnite than every other shooter available on the industry from Call of Duty to CS:GO to Battlefield into Destiny. It's a complete monster.

Epic found itself in a special position as it watched PUBG blow up before its eyes, using its own engine, Unreal and stood . Fortnite had been designed as a build-focused defense match for numerous years (sources inform me that the game was in the works for nearly a decade), but Epic's flexibility allowed it to experimentation with its own spin on a Battle Royale style. Make a map full of destructible objects, use the controllers and building mechanics of the Fortnite, and voila, you have your BR title on the industry as the genre is really starting to heat up. This has upset PUBG to no conclusion, but a genre can't be copyrighted by you, and Epic happened to be at the right place at the right time with the ideal motor to work with.

Part of the reason why Fortnite continues to be such a victory, and is is in regards to every aspect of the game's development, because Epic is really damn quickly. Fortnite isn't the most intricate game in the world to begin with, but include the fact that Epic is currently working with Unreal their engine, and that results in speed in all areas. Fortnite got to consoles before PUBG, it is becoming to mobile before any shot, really. While Destiny 2 takes six weeks to correct a bugged quest icon the sport is continually upgraded and patched, where additions and fixes often take no longer than a few days to make their way into a match. Epic's speed is what is helped push the success of Fortnite more than almost any other factor.

Fortnite has something for everyone, for the most part. Unless you've made it all the way to the end matches are brief and fast, and it's easy whenever you want to drop in for a few. The squad system lets you play solo, with a group, or with a friend, based on who and matchmaking is an absolute breeze compared to most games in the genre. It's also accessible to any level of players. You can most likely make it to the best 20 pretty readily, a sense of achievement even when you're not a killer if you are good at running and hiding. You can do that too if you would like to be a Fortnite god, and mastering engagements, building and the map is an prospect at the game's greatest levels. However, every game feels...gratifying. If you die instantly, you can begin over in an instant. Should you die in the middle, you'll feel good about outliving those initial 20-40 suckers. You may feel as if you're pretty great, if you expire at the end. The BR format is addicting and does not drain you how constant declines in other games do since you are supposed to"lose" the vast bulk of this moment.
